Hybrid CO2 capture-utilization-storage models converting emissions into economic value.
TechXearthspace develops low-cost hybrid CO2 capture, utilization and storage (Hy-CCUS) systems that convert emissions into economic value. Our modular technology intensifies CO2 capture and delivers tailored end-to-end solutions for customers, enabling carbon credits and creating scalable climate-positive ecosystems across multiple industries.
Equity-free grants include: Rs 4,00,000 from the Grassroot Innovation Programme, Government of Karnataka; Rs 3,00,000 as a cash prize from the Ministry of Coal; Rs 4,00,000 from TIDE 2.0 from MeitY; Rs 10,00,000 from NIDHI PRAYAS from DST; and Rs 10,00,000 from the Cummins Foundation via the Climate Collective Foundation.
Scalable system and process for selective capturing of carbon dioxide, its utilization, and storage using non-linear wave mechanics.
First runner-up, Hackathon on CCUS Technology, Ministry of Coal. Winner of Grassroot Innovation Programme, Department of Electronics, IT, BT and Science & Technology, Government of Karnataka. Top 14 finalists at Low Carbon Earth Accelerator Program conducted by UN Environment Program and Massive Earth Foundation. Top 3 (of 7 companies) women-led climate tech start-up, UN Women Asia and Pacific.
A two-member multidisciplinary team with strong research and industry experience from IIT Madras, USC, Hebrew University, and UT Dallas, combining deep technical and business expertise in CO2 capture, energy systems, and climate-tech commercialization.
